Marshawn Lynch Reaches Plea Deal in Las Vegas DUI Case

TL;DR Summary
Former NFL player Marshawn Lynch took a plea deal in his Las Vegas DUI case, where the charge could be lowered to reckless driving if he fulfills certain requirements, including DUI school, community service, and staying out of trouble for a year. Prosecutors suspect Lynch had a blood alcohol level more than twice the legal limit when police found him sleeping in a car near the Las Vegas Strip in 2022. This is not Lynch's first driving-related incident, as he was previously involved in a crash and cited for stopping, standing, or parking prohibited in specified places.
